Med Center Health breaks ground on upcoming Glasgow location
GLASGOW, Ky. (WBKO) - Today, Med Center Health was joined by members of the Barren County Chamber of Commerce to break ground on their new location in Glasgow. They are partnering with Stengel Hill Architecture to construct the 22,000-square-foot facility. It will feature an outpatient diagnostic imaging center, which will offer radiology, ultrasound, mammography, nuclear medicine CT, and MRI services.

Glasgow man indicted after March shooting that injured brothers
GLASGOW, Ky. (WBKO) – A Barren County grand jury has indicted a man after he allegedly shot two brothers in March with a shotgun. Kevin L. Abner, 59, was indicted on one count of first-degree assault and one count of second-degree assault. The indictments were returned on April 17.
Man arrested following burglary at Glasgow Mexican restaurant
GLASGOW, Ky. (WBKO) – Authorities in Glasgow say a man was caught on video overnight burglarizing a Mexican restaurant. Police responded early Monday morning upon discovering that Los Mariachis had been burglarized overnight. They found a broken window at the restaurant and a large hole in the wall where the suspect had gained entry.
